Naturally, to use BBot you have to (unfortunately) add a exception to BBot.exe and BDll.dll.
The problem is that BBot is released every couple weeks/months, while a Photoshop for example is released once a year and used by millions of users. BBot.exe and BDll.dll are always 'flesh', updated, code changed.
BBot act like a virus (like I said before, BBot will control other process [tibia.exe], and that's exactly how virus does their job).
